    First off, we have the legendary Efren “Bata” Reyes, often hailed as the “Magician.” His incredible shot-making ability, combined with his captivating presence, has made him a global icon. Then there’s Francisco “Django” Bustamante, another Filipino billiards legend, known for his aggressive style and numerous world titles. These guys have paved the way for the new generation of Filipino players, showing them what's possible and inspiring them to reach for the stars.

    Then comes the new wave! Players like Carlo Biado, known for his steady nerves and impressive consistency, have made waves on the international stage.     The History of Billiards in the Philippines

    Okay, let's take a quick trip back in time to understand where this passion for the game comes from. The history of billiards in the Philippines is deeply rooted in the culture, with the sport evolving from a simple form of entertainment to a national pastime and a source of national pride. Billiards was introduced to the Philippines during the Spanish colonial period, becoming popular among the elite and gradually spreading to the general population.

    As the sport grew in popularity, local tournaments and competitions began to emerge, fostering a competitive environment and attracting a dedicated following. The development of billiards infrastructure, including the construction of billiards halls and the availability of equipment, further fueled the sport's expansion.
